I am trying to verify my site on the Magento new security scanner https://account.magento.com/scanner/index/form/ but every time I try to verify I get an error Unable to verify this site. Please recheck your verification code and try again! I am using domain name and HTML Comment. I cannot see the code in my source when I put the code on my site which I believe that's why it can't be verified. How can I resolve this issue please. Click Generate Confirmation Code and Copy that generated code, follow the below steps and paste the code

1. Click System > Configuration > General > Design. You can add the code to either your HTML header or footer.
2. To add it to the head, click HTML Head and enter the code in the Miscellaneous Scripts field.
3. When you're finished, click Save Config.

If still not coming means something blocking in your .htaccess file or firewall.

  • any restriction on your site URL? Because I too faced an issue like this if we have htaccess password protection for the site means this issue will come. I removed that protection after that it worked for me. Mar 1, 2018 at 13:08

Replace your .htaccess with the default one. Then add the code to the site, this time the scanner should accept your site to test. Get the scan report and then place original .htacess file.
